    Afghanistan and Uzbekistan Hold Joint Trade Meeting in Termez

    The Ministry of Industry and Commerce announced that a joint trade meeting between Afghanistan and Uzbekistan took place in Termez, Uzbekistan. The meeting was led by Afghanistan’s Acting Minister of Industry and Commerce, Nooruddin Azizi, and Uzbekistan’s
    Minister of Investment, Industry, and Trade, Laziz Kudratov.

    Discussions focused on Uzbekistan’s potential investments in various economic sectors in Afghanistan, including the establishment of an economic-trade complex in the industrial town of Hairatan, food production and processing, poultry farming, pharmaceuticals, cement production, construction materials, and the cultivation of pistachio orchards. Additionally, investment opportunities valued at over $200 million were discussed for processing vegetables and fruits in the provinces of Samangan, Balkh, and Kunduz.

    Following the meeting, both delegations visited the designated site for the planned economic complex.
